FLETCHER, N.C. — Four months ago, depressed and prepared to die, Kirk Jones sent himself sailing over the Canadian side of Niagara Falls.
Today, he's a member of the Toby Tyler Circus, billed as an oddity alongside Ziggy and Iggy, the two-headed pig.
Jones, 41, became the first person to survive a plunge over that side of the falls without wearing any sort of protective device. A 7-year-old boy survived the plunge with a lifejacket in 1960.
